Simplify the following experssions (a b c are all vectors) a times (b times (a times b)); (c) (a - b) middot (b - c) times (c - a);

Solution

Note : a x ( b x c ) = b( a.c ) - c( a.b )

(b) b x ( a x b ) = a( b.b ) - b( b.a )

Let , a.a = L , a.b = M and b.b = N

=> a x ( b x ( a x b ) ) = a x ( a( b.b ) - b( b.a ) )

=> a x ( b x ( a x b ) ) = ( a x Na ) - M( a x b )

As , a x a = 0

=> a x ( b x ( a x b ) ) = -M( a x b )

(c) (b - c) x (c - a) = (b x c) - (b x a) - (c x c) + (c x a)

=> (b - c) x (c - a) = (b x c) - (b x a) + (c x a)

=> (a - b) . (b - c) x (c - a) = a.( (b x c) - (b x a) + (c x a) ) - b.( (b x c) - (b x a) + (c x a) )

=> (a - b) . (b - c) x (c - a) = a.(b x c) - b.(c x a)

=> (a - b) . (b - c) x (c - a) = [ a b c ] - [ a b c ] = 0
